When two torques of equal magnitude act in … Nettet12. sep. 2024 · The linear variable of position has physical units of meters, whereas the angular position variable has dimensionless units of radians, as can be seen from the definition of θ = s r, which is the ratio of two lengths. The linear velocity has units of m/s, and its counterpart, the angular velocity, has units of rad/s. langerhans\\u0027 cell histiocytosis
